About

Yajun Ji is a scholar working on Renewable Energy, Sustainability and the Environment, Electronic, Optical and Magnetic Materials and Electrical and Electronic Engineering. According to data from OpenAlex, Yajun Ji has authored 63 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Renewable Energy, Sustainability and the Environment, 31 papers in Electronic, Optical and Magnetic Materials and 30 papers in Electrical and Electronic Engineering. Recurrent topics in Yajun Ji’s work include Supercapacitor Materials and Fabrication (29 papers), Advanced battery technologies research (23 papers) and Electrocatalysts for Energy Conversion (20 papers). Yajun Ji is often cited by papers focused on Supercapacitor Materials and Fabrication (29 papers), Advanced battery technologies research (23 papers) and Electrocatalysts for Energy Conversion (20 papers). Yajun Ji collaborates with scholars based in China and United States. Yajun Ji's co-authors include Fei Chen, Hongmei Wu, Dong Shi, He‐Gen Zheng, Zhixiang Tong, Jun‐Jie Zhu, Anna Cristina S. Samia, Jianping He, Jianhua Zhou and Abulikemu Abulizi and has published in prestigious journals such as Chemical Communications, Journal of Power Sources and Chemical Engineering Journal.
